As part of the series of events celebrating the 80th anniversary of National Day September 2, the Central Propaganda and Mass Mobilization Commission directed Netmedia and related units to organize the program "Rock Concert - Heart of Vietnam" at 8:00 p.m. on September 6 at the Thang Long Imperial Citadel Relic Site, Hanoi .

The program features the participation of top Vietnamese bands such as Buc Tuong, Ngu Cung, Chillies, The Flob, Blue Whales and guest singers Pham Anh Khoa, Pham Thu Ha, Duong Tran Nghia...

The organizers shared their desire to bring a new, youthful and more energetic art space. Rock is a strong, liberal music genre, associated with the spirit of freedom and aspiration. When revolutionary songs are dressed in the spirit of rock, they become a new voice, close and attractive to the young generation.

To bring new experiences to the audience, for the first time, the program brings the Thanh Am Xanh folk band together with a rock band. This fusion not only creates a unique and powerful sound, but also affirms that the spirit of Vietnamese folk music can resonate and blend in any stage space, any era, even on a liberal rock background.

The organizers also hope that the program will be a bridge for history to touch the hearts of young people through music.
